Q: Is 6,062,523 a Prime Number?
A: No, 6,062,523 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 6062523 can be evenly divided by 1 3 17 51 118,873 356,619 2,020,841 and 6,062,523, with no remainder.
Since 6,062,523 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,062,523, it is not a prime number.
